Facebook’s partnership with the U.S. Department of Labor to use social media to get Americans back to work might be a disaster for the ruling professional network, LinkedIn.

Today, the Social Jobs Partnership launched a Social Jobs App that aggregates more than 1.7 million job listings on Facebook, creating a sizable job board for the social network’s growing user base of more than 167.5 million people in the U.S. alone. The app gives candidates the opportunity to apply for jobs through Facebook and share listings with their friends.
